Hello bettyespana

Have no credits for Scotlands People.  However - a free search shows that in all of Scotland from 1855 to 1900.  there are only 2 Alexander Harp deaths.  No point in searching before 1855 - as it won't show his parents.

Birth - Narrow it down to 10 years either side of 1783 and only 1 death entry.

This one dies in Aberdeen(shire) in 1862

If this is your man - his death entry should give his occupation, wifes name and if she is alive, also both parents names and occupation of father.

You should be able to narrow him down from census records, and from wifes death entry.

Minimum spend on SP is £6.   Gives possibility to download 5 diferent 'extracts'.

As a bonus there are 2 entries in the 'Wills' sections of www.scotlandspeople.gov.uk both will cost £5 to download - you don't use 'credits' - you put them in a basket then purchase them at a check out as you would with Amazon or similar sites.

1 Harp Alexander 14/07/1863 Lighthouse Keeper in Aberdeen T. 14/07/1863 SC1/37/52/p139 See Also SC1/36/53/1 Aberdeen Sheriff Court Wills SC1/37/52 VIEW (£5.00)
(7 pages)
2 Harp Alexander 14/07/1863 Lighthouse Keeper in Aberdeen, died at No. 10 Canal Saint Aberdeen T. 14/07/1863 SC1/37/52/p139 Aberdeen Sheriff Court Inventories SC1/36/53 VIEW (£5.00)

This is a will and an inventory. The inventory is a list of his possessions, and the will is his instructions on what to do with them. If you don't want to pay two lost of £5, the will is likely to be more useful.
